Mitchell’s NJPW Fighting Spirit Unleashed Results & Report! (11/8/24)
Who is truly NJPW Strong?

The Japanese Young Punk takes on the Mad Man!
NJPW visits Lowell Memorial Auditorium to have a battle of young stars! Will Gabe Kidd be NJPW Strong? Or will Kosei Fujita rename this all NJPW Mighty?
OFFICIAL RESULTS
- Kickoff – Strong Survivor Match: Matt Vandagriff VS Seabass Finn; Vandagriff wins.
- David Finlay VS Kevin Knight; Finlay wins.
- NJPW Strong Openweight Tag Team Championships: Shane Haste & Mikey Nicholls VS Grizzled Young Veterans; Grizzled Young Veterans win and become the new NJPW Strong Openweight Tag Team Champions.
- Lio Rush VS Mustafa Ali; Lio wins.
- Best 2 Out of 3 Tag Match: Fred Rosser & Tom Lawlor VS West Coast Wrecking Crew; WCWC wins.
- NJPW Strong Women’s Championship #1 Contender’s Fatal 4 Way: Anna Jay VS Trish Adora VS Hazuki VS Koguma; Hazuki wins and will challenge Mercedes Mone for the title.
- Shingo Takagi & Yota Tsuji VS The Kingdom; Takagi & Tsuij win.
- Ryohei Oiwa VS KENTA; Ryohei wins.
- Zack Sabre Jr. & Bad Dude Tito VS Shota Umino & Tomohiro Ishii; Shota & Ishii win.
- AEW International Championship: Konosuke Takeshita VS TJP; Konosuke wins and retains.
- NJPW Strong Openweight Championship: Gabe Kidd VS Kosei Fujita; Gabe wins and retains.

My Thoughts:
A great night for NJPW, but I wish I had more time for it. Them doing these NJPW Strong shows on Fridays is always rough given there’s WWE SmackDown and AEW Rampage. Speaking of Rampage, we got more overlapping between NJPW and AEW: The Kingdom lose to LIJ here while winning a Triple Threat on Rampage, and then Lio Rush wins two matches on the same night. But at least they planned ahead with Mone so that she didn’t have an appearance on Rampage while she was here to go after Hazuki. Great Fatal 4 Way to determine a contender, and I figured it would be a Stardom wrestler, not an AEW wrestler, that won here. While Mone is more likely dropping the NJPW title than she is the TBS title at this point, I don’t see her losing to Hazuki.
While I didn’t cover it, great showing from Kevin Knight against David Finlay, but of course Finlay won. Finlay is still Global Heavyweight Champion, set to face Tsuji for that belt. Apparently Tsuji’s gonna be real busy, with Jack Perry showing up to attack and set up a match with him. I feel like Garcia should win the title off Jack first. If Jack faces Tsuji while still TNT Champion, it heavily tips their match in Jack’s favor. But if Jack isn’t a champion, then Tsuij can win and he won’t be owed a title match or anything.
The Three Stages of Strong was wild, I couldn’t help but want that one on record. And at one point, Veda Scott on commentary said just what I was thinking, they really subverted expectations in those first two falls. WCWC are big buff boys who should’ve won the Tables match, but didn’t. And both Rosser and Lawlor have submission finishers, but they lose the submission match. A tag team Last Man Standing match is a rather big brain stipulation, not sure they needed straps. Rosser got busted open hard way and certainly not planned, but it added a lot of drama to how that match finished, and it was a big win for WCWC.
WCWC then calling out the Strong Tag Champs was a fitting move. GYV VS TMDK was great stuff, and a great win for GYV. I suppose Shane & Mikey losing the IWGP Tag titles did open the way for them to lose more belts, and it’s fine since GYV have been stateside and can defend the Strong titles more often. Shane & Mikey will be in World Tag League for sure, and might win out to get their rematch. At the same time, look at how big they’re doing the Junior Heavyweight Tag title scene where former champs get a rematch anyway.
TMDK got a lot of other stuff tonight, though Bad Dude Tito was of course taking that loss. That builds Shota up as he and ZSJ are going to battle over the IWGP World Heavyweight Championship next. And then Ryohei got a great win over Kenta that also played out later. Awesome title matches to close, but I figured the status quos would be kept there. Konosuke VS Takagi is going to be awesome no matter what titles are on the line, and it seems like Ishii wants to at least face the winner. Gabe VS Fujita was great, and Ryohei coming after Gabe was also good stuff. Feels like Gabe & Kenta VS Ryohei & Fujita is a tune-up tag match waiting to happen, and who knows how Ryohei VS Gabe goes when it happens.
